![](https://i.imgur.com/lGhPn42t.png)
![](https://i.imgur.com/3wIv6yCt.png)
Il s'agit d'une bibliothèque offrant des possibilités de tracé dans un repère orthogonal, conformément aux programmes de Mathématiques et Physique-Chimie. Au menu nous avons les types de diagrammes suivants :
- nuage de points
- diagramme en ligne brisée
- droite de régression linéaire
![](https://i.imgur.com/Tqr7MvEt.png)
![](https://i.imgur.com/lRjV8yQt.png)
![](https://i.imgur.com/pKZ66lVt.png)
line(x1,x2,y1,y2,"mode")
.On peut éventuellement faire précéder son appel d'un réglage du stylo.
![](https://i.imgur.com/JfJtQUit.png)
- Code: Select all
from ti_system import *
import ti_plotlib as plt
lta = ('thin', 'medium', 'thick')
lty = ('solid', 'dot', 'dash')
lmo = ('default', 'arrow')
nta, nty = len(lta), len(lty)
lx = [plt.xmin + k*(plt.xmax-plt.xmin)/(2*nta+1) for k in range(1, 2*nta+1)]
ly = [plt.ymin + k*(plt.ymax-plt.ymin)/(2*nty+1) for k in range(1, 2*nty+1)]
l = (plt.xmax-plt.xmin) / (2*nta+1)
plt.cls()
disp_at(1, ' '*4 + (' '*4).join(lta), 'left')
for i in range(len(lty)):
disp_at(10 - 4*i, lty[i], 'left')
for j in range(len(lta)):
plt.pen(lta[j], lty[i])
for k in range(len(lmo)):
plt.line(lx[j*2], ly[i*2 + k], lx[j*2 + 1], ly[i*2 + k], lmo[k])
plt.show_plot()
Cela peut notamment servir à tracer des champs de vecteurs en Physique-Chimie.
Mais dans un contexte scolaire,
Si il n'est certes pas bien difficile de les calculer, ce serait quand même lourd d'avoir à le faire systématiquement à chaque fois.
line(x1,x2,y1,y2,"arrow")
n'est pas quelque chose de pratique. On ne dispose usuellement pas de ces données, mais des coordonnées du point d'origine et des coordonnées du vecteur.Si il n'est certes pas bien difficile de les calculer, ce serait quand même lourd d'avoir à le faire systématiquement à chaque fois.
![](https://i.imgur.com/yPWB4C4t.png)
ce_quivr est un module Python additionnel à charger sur ta calculatrice, et offrant une fonction un peu plus usuelle de tracé de vecteur dans un repère.
![](https://i.imgur.com/WnJOUTXt.png)
![](https://i.imgur.com/WnJOUTXt.png)
quiver(x,y,dx,dy,échelle,"couleur")
.![](https://i.imgur.com/IFw8zOdt.png)
D'une part, le menu se retrouvait être un mélange de Français et d'Anglais, avec couleur qui devenait color.
![](https://i.imgur.com/NqFaamLt.png)
![](https://i.imgur.com/wCklRwpt.png)
- Code: Select all
#spécification connue :
quiver(x,y,dx,dy,échelle,"color")
quiver(x,y,dx,dy,échelle,"color","?")
#forme saisie erronée :
quiver(,,,,"blk","vector")
#forme corrigée :
quiver(,,,,,"blk","vector")
Source : https://resources.t3france.fr/t3france
Téléchargements :
- OS 5.6.1 + applis pour TI-83 Premium CE / TI-84 Plus CE
- OS 5.6.1 pour TI-83 Premium CE / TI-84 Plus
- application Python 5.5.2.0044
- modules Python graphiques :
- ce_quivr - tuto-vidéo
- ce_turtl français english - tuto-vidéo
- ce_box - tuto-vidéo
- ce_chart - tuto-vidéo